Verdict
Twice a winner here and much improved, FIRST LINK had no chance in a Class 2 at Chelmsford last time but is back in the right grade here and receiving weight from all-bar-one of her rivals so has every chance of getting back to winning ways. Call Me Grumpy is still seeking a first win on the all-weather but has been knocking on the door and is unlikely to be far away again. It Must Be Faith has a wide draw but could also play a part and Nezar has Jack Duern’s claim in his favour. Gunmaker and Marshal Dan are returning from a break but Stormy Blues is worth considering under Luke Morris.
